1270 FEDERAL ST BELCHERTOWN, MA 01007 Get Directions
1270 FEDERAL ST BELCHERTOWN, MA 01007 Get Directions
In business for 15 years, Amherst Self Storage is a professional quality self storage facility. We specialize self storage for all you belongings, whether it is long term or for a short time. We have a state-of-the-art facility with the best customer service around! When you rent from us, you'll have 24-hour access to your belongings. Give us a call or book online today!
© Dun & Bradstreet, Inc. 2025.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.